After taking a close look at Carson Wentz’s four-touchdown performance against the Arizona Cardinals, let’s change gears and break down the defensive effort. It was a game where the Eagles allowed just seven points on the scoreboard despite the fact that the Cardinals were in catch up mode for most of the afternoon.

What I loved about the victory was that the Eagles never went into autopilot in any phase of the game. The same relentless and aggressive style that got them an early three-score lead carried through until the final whistle. That’s why in our very first shot today I want to look at the Eagles' final defensive play.
